Automation: Security notice for variable usage

June 3
Enhancement
VSA 10, Kaseya 365 Endpoint

A new security notice is now displayed when working with variables in Automation Scripts and Workflows, helping administrators and technicians make more informed decisions when handling sensitive data. This enhancement reinforces security best practices and increases awareness of how variables are used within automation processes.
